Agrifood Systems Waste Disposal — Emissions (CO2eq) from N2O in Mali
Mali: Agrifood Systems Waste Disposal — Emissions (CO2eq) from N2O was 159.4 kt in 2023. ▲ Rising
Agrifood Systems Waste Disposal — Emissions (CO2eq) from N2O in Mali, 1990–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
Mali recorded 159.4 kt for agrifood systems waste disposal — emissions (co2eq) from n2o in 2023. That is the highest value across all 34 years on record.
The figure is up 3.0% on the previous year and up 17.3% over ten years.
Over the whole period, agrifood systems waste disposal — emissions (co2eq) from n2o in Mali peaked at 159.4 kt in 2023 and was at its lowest, 56.66 kt, in 1990.
That places Mali 58th out of 205 countries with data for 2023, putting it in the middle of the range.
The long-run direction has been consistently rising across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
